KCET Toppers 2025- Karnataka Examinations Authority has released the KCET 2025 exam toppers list online. The list of KCET toppers 2025 has been updated on this page. The list includes the names of examinees who scored the highest marks in KCET 2025. The authority conducted the Karnataka CET exam on April 16 and 17, 2025, while the Kannada medium test was held on April 15, 2025. The top 3 KCET 2025 Toppers are Bhavesh Jayanthi (rank 1), Satwik B Biradar (rank 2) and Dhinesh Gomathi Shankar Arunachalam (rank 3). The top 10 rankers with their merit percentage have been mentioned in this article. The KCET 2025 result was declared online on May 24, 2025. The toppers of KCET 2025 list have been updated online. KEA released the Karnataka CET toppers list along with the result only. Qualified candidates will be eligible to participate in KCET 2025 counselling. Candidates can find the KCET 2025 toppers list below
Rank | Student Name | Merit % | Board |
---|---|---|---|
1 | Bhavesh Jayanthi | 99.06 | CBSE in Karnataka |
2 | Satwik B Biradar | 98.83 | CBSE in Karnataka |
3 | Dhinesh Gomathi Shankar Arunachalam | 98.67 | CBSE in Karnataka |
4 | Shishir H Shetty | 98.61 | Karnataka (State Board) |
5 | Divyansh Agrawal | 98.56 | CBSE in Karnataka |
6 | Tharun A Surana | 98.56 | Karnataka (State Board) |
7 | Karan Koder | 98.44 | Karnataka (State Board) |
8 | Rishabh Pandey | 98.39 | CBSE in Karnataka |
9 | Chaithanya Parama Shivam | 98.33 | CBSE in Karnataka |
10 | Sarath Chandar M | 98.17 | CBSE in Karnataka |

Yes, your daughter is still allowed to go for the vacancy round in KCET counselling.
The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) after the third round, typically holds a vacancy round, which is an extended or special round, to fill those seats that are left unallocated due to withdrawals or unreported admissions.
As her KCET rank is 34,000, she still has quite a good shot of attaining a seat, especially in private or newly established engineering colleges, or in branches that have lesser demand.
Just frequently visit the official KEA website for the latest updates about the vacancy or casual round schedule, and be all set with the documents so that she can participate at the earliest when the portal goes live.
